Another way to save money on home improvements is by focusing on the small details. Sometimes, simple changes can make a big impact. For example, replacing old switch plates and outlet covers with new ones can give your home a more modern look. You can also change the doorknobs and handles on your cabinets and drawers to add a touch of elegance. Don’t forget about your windows – you can update them by adding new curtains or blinds to match your home’s color scheme. Lastly, consider making eco-friendly upgrades to your home. Not only are these upgrades better for the environment, but they can also save you money in the long run. For instance, installing low-flow faucets and showerheads can significantly reduce your water bill. You can also switch to energy-efficient appliances, such as refrigerators, washing machines, and air conditioners. These may require a higher upfront cost, but they will save you money on your utility bills in the long run.

When it comes to adding some personality to your home, you don’t have to spend a fortune on expensive artwork. Instead, get creative and make your own pieces. You can create a gallery wall with framed photos, prints, and posters. You can also add some greenery to your space by incorporating indoor plants. Not only do they add a touch of nature to your home, but they also have numerous health benefits. You can find affordable plants at your local nursery or even propagate your own from clippings of existing plants.

One area of the home that often gets overlooked is the lighting. Upgrading your lighting can make a significant impact on the overall look and feel of your home. Instead of buying expensive light fixtures, consider using energy-efficient LED bulbs. They are not only cost-effective, but they also last longer and consume less electricity. You can also add some ambiance to your living space by incorporating some statement pieces, such as a unique floor lamp or a string of fairy lights.

Another way to save money on home improvements is by doing it yourself. While some projects may require professional help, there are plenty of tasks you can tackle on your own. For example, painting a room or installing new fixtures and hardware can be easily done with a little bit of research and some basic tools. You can also save money by repurposing old items or using inexpensive materials. For instance, instead of buying new cabinets, you can give your old ones a fresh coat of paint and replace the hardware for a fraction of the cost.

One of the most effective ways to transform your home is by decluttering and organizing. It may seem like a simple task, but a clutter-free home can make a significant difference in the overall look and feel of your space. Start by getting rid of items you no longer need or use. You can donate or sell these items to make some extra cash for your home improvement projects. Next, invest in some storage solutions to keep your belongings organized and out of sight. This will create a more spacious and visually appealing living space.
